How will I receive the vaccine and how many doses?

​You will receive the vaccine as an injection, most commonly into your upper arm muscle. Please wear clothing with easy access to your arm.  

​You must remain in the vaccination clinic for observation for at least 15 minutes after vaccination.

 
It is important that you receive two doses of the COVID-19 vaccine to be fully protected.

AstraZeneca vaccines need to be at least 12 weeks apart.
Pfizer vaccines are 3 weeks apart.

Full protection against COVID-19 will not occur until about a week after your second dose.
